摘要:
The cesium salt of R, R-(-)-trans-l, 2-cyclohexane-diaminetetraacetatocobaltate(III), Δ-(+)546-Cs[Co(R, R(-)-CDTA)], Δ-Cs[Co(R, R(-)CDTA)]), provides a compound which can be used for calibration of circular dichrometers in the visible region. Δ-Cs[Co(R, R(-)CDTA)] has three major circular dichroism (CD) maxima at 593 nm, 527 nm, and 240 nm. The molecular ellipticities, [], at 593 nm, 527 nm, and 240 nm are -4490 ± 40, 5720 ± 40, and -47, 900 ± 300 deg cm2dmol−1, respectively. The CD maxima in terms of Δε at 593, 527, and 240 nm are -1.36 ± 0.01, 1.73 ± 0.01, and -14.5 ± 0.1 l cm−1mol−1, respectively. Optical rotatory dispersion (ORD) and ultraviolet-visible absorption data has also been obtained for this compound.
